Issue: "Application fails to start because side-by-side configuration is incorrect." Solution: Install the missing Visual C++ Redistributable packages (2010–2015). The portable version relies on these system components.

Issue: Portable settings won't save after restart.
Solution: Ensure the folder containing the .exe is not write-protected. Also, run the application as Administrator once to generate the initial .ini configuration file.
